October 17

Tuesday Morning October the 17th 1727

Met again according to adjournment. Present as yesterday with
the Addition of Nicholas Lowe Esqr
Read the petition of Daniell Manadier of the Parish of St Peters
in Talbott County Clerk praying to be naturalized
Read the Petition of Josias Sunderland of Calvert County pray-
ing an Amendment of the Law lately made in his favour
Ordered That the said Petitions be severally thus Endors'd viz.

By the Upper House of Assembly October the 17th 1727

Read and recommended to the Consideracon of the Lower house
of Assembly
Signed p Order Geo. Plater Cl. Up. Ho.

Sent by Colo Matt. T. Ward
Read the Petition of the Inhabitants of Baltimore County pray-
ing a further Encouragement for makeing Hemp Ordered that the
said Petition be thus Endorsed viz.

By the Upper house of Assembly October the 17th 1727

Read and referred to the Consideracon of the Lower House of
Assembly.
Signed p Order Geo. Plater Cl. Up. Ho.

p. 11

Sent down by John Rousby Esqr
A Bill from the Lower House by Mr Henry Hawkins and John
Kirk Entituled An Act to make valid a Deed of bargain and Sale
from William Rogers and Mary his wife to John Teneson of Charles
County when Recorded thus Endorst viz.

By the Lower house of Assembly October 17th 1727
Read the first time and ordered to lye on the Table
Sign'd p order M Jenefer Cl. Low. Ho.
